Warning Signs You Need Truck-Mounted Water Extraction

Catching these signs early can save you money and prevent bigger problems. Don’t ignore the following warning signs:

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away

Unpleasant odors can be a sign of hidden moisture. If you notice a musty smell that won’t go away, it’s time to call us.

Water Stains on Ceilings or Walls

Visible water stains can be a sign of a more serious issue. If you notice water stains on your ceilings or walls, don’t wait, call us today.

Warped or Buckled Flooring

Warped or buckled flooring can be a sign of water damage. If you notice any changes in your flooring, it’s time to call us.

Peeling Paint or Wallpaper

Peeling paint or wallpaper can be a sign of hidden moisture. If you notice any peeling or bubbling, don’t wait, call us today.

Water Damage in Your Attic or Crawlspace

Water damage in your attic or crawlspace can be a serious issue. If you notice any signs of water damage in these areas, call us immediately.

Truck-Mounted Water Extraction vs. DIY: When To Call a Professional

Situation DIY? Call a Pro? Why
Small water spill in the kitchen Yes No DIY methods can handle small spills, but be sure to clean and dry the area thoroughly to prevent further damage.
Standing water in the basement after a flood No Yes Standing water can cause serious damage and health risks. Call a professional to extract the water and dry the area.
Water damage in a single room No Yes Water damage in a single room can still cause significant problems. Call a professional to ensure the job is done right.
Water damage in multiple rooms or areas No Yes Water damage in multiple rooms or areas needs professional attention to prevent further damage and ensure safety.

Truck-Mounted Water Extraction Cost in Laguna Beach, CA

The cost of Truck-Mounted Water Extraction in Laguna Beach, CA, can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ions. Our estimates are free and based on an on-site assessment. Here are some typical price ranges for different aspects of the service:

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Truck-Mounted Water Extraction $500 – $2,500 Severity of damage, size of affected area, and local conditions.
Drying and Dehumidification $200 – $1,000 Size of affected area and duration of drying process.
Inspection and Repairs $100 – $500 Scope of repairs and materials needed.
Moisture Detection $100 – $300 Size of affected area and complexity of detection process.
